King Edward VIII. First edition, first impression, handsomely bound. Based on unrestricted access to the royal archives at Windsor, Ziegler charts Edward's course from prince of Wales, king, governor of the Bahamas, and effective exile as the Duke of Windsor. Edward is presented as a charming lightweight lacking the discretion and sense of proportion to lead; Wallis Simpson is presented unfavourably as ruthless, shallow, and greedy.
